Troubadour® 2F is labeled for control of lepidopterous larvae, including a wide variety of worms and gypsy moths in plants which include grapes, fruiting vegetables, cotton, corn, soybeans, leafy green vegetables, caneberries and many other agricultural crops. It is a group 18 insecticide that contains the active ingredient methoxyfenozide in the diacylhydrazine class, which has a novel mode of action that mimics the action of the molting hormone of lepidopterous (moths, butterflies) larvae. Upon ingestion, larval stages of the order lepidoptera undergo an incomplete and developmentally lethal premature molt. This process interrupts and rapidly halts their feeding. Feeding typically ceases within hours of ingestion, although complete mortality of the larvae may take several days. Affected larvae often become lethargic and often develop discolored areas or bands between segments.
